During natural conception, an embryo must shed its protective outer shell (zona pellucida) before it can attach to the uterine wall. In some patients, this shell is abnormally thick or hard, preventing successful implantation even when embryo quality is good.
LAH uses a highly controlled infrared laser — not a scalpel, not chemicals — to create a tiny, precise hole in that shell. The embryo is never harmed; only the shell is thinned. This small intervention can make a significant difference for couples who have had one or more failed IVF cycles despite having good-quality embryos transferred.

Step-by-Step: The Laser Assisted Hatching IVF Procedure
Understanding the LAH process helps demystify fertility treatment and sets realistic expectations. Here is how the procedure unfolds within a HomeIVF-coordinated cycle for patients in Sector 41 and across Noida.
Step 1 — Ovarian Stimulation: Fertility hormones are self-administered at home (with HomeIVF nurse support) to stimulate egg development over 8–12 days.
Step 2 — Egg Retrieval: Performed under sedation at a partner embryology centre, this minor procedure collects mature eggs from the ovaries.
Step 3 — Fertilisation: Eggs are fertilised with partner or donor sperm in the laboratory. Fertilised eggs develop into embryos over 3–5 days.
Step 4 — Embryo Assessment: The embryology team evaluates embryo quality, grading, and zona pellucida thickness. Based on HomeIVF Medical Board protocols, LAH is recommended for eligible embryos.
Step 5 — Laser Hatching: A focused infrared laser creates a precise micro-opening in the zona pellucida on Day 3 or Day 5 of embryo development, just before transfer.
Step 6 — Embryo Transfer: The hatched embryo is gently placed into the uterus — a quick, generally pain-free procedure.
Step 7 — Post-Transfer Support: HomeIVF coordinators guide you through the two-week wait with luteal support medications, scheduled check-ins, and emotional care from your Sector 41 home.

Not every IVF patient requires Laser Assisted Hatching (LAH), and responsible clinical practice demands patient-specific decision-making. The HomeIVF Medical Board follows evidence-based international guidelines when recommending LAH for patients in Sector 41 and across Noida.
Clinically validated indications for LAH include: women aged 38 years or older (where zona hardening is more common), couples with two or more failed IVF or ICSI cycles despite good embryo quality, embryos that were cryopreserved and thawed (frozen embryo transfers often benefit from LAH), embryos graded as slow-developing or showing morphological irregularities, and patients with an elevated baseline FSH level indicating diminished ovarian reserve.
The benefit of LAH lies in improving the embryo-endometrium synchrony — giving the embryo a head start on emerging from its shell at precisely the right implantation window. Importantly, LAH does not replace good embryo quality or optimal endometrial preparation; it complements them.

Is the LAH procedure painful or risky for the embryo?+
Laser Assisted Hatching is a well-established, minimally invasive embryology technique. The laser acts only on the zona pellucida — the outer shell — and does not contact or damage the embryo itself. The procedure takes approximately 5–10 minutes and is performed under strict laboratory conditions by trained embryologists. International data does not show an increased risk of embryo damage, monozygotic twinning, or birth defects when LAH is performed by experienced teams.
